Questions & Answers about او معمولاً آنلاین نیست چون گوشی ندارد.
Where should I place adverbs of frequency like معمولاً in a Farsi sentence?
In Farsi, adverbs of frequency like معمولاً (usually) typically come right after the subject, just like او (he/she) in this sentence. They can also go at the very beginning of the sentence for emphasis, but putting them immediately after the subject is the standard word order.
What is the little double-line symbol at the end of معمولاً?
That symbol is a special Arabic ending used in Farsi called tanvin. It makes an 'an' sound. You will see it on many adverbs of frequency and degree, making the word معمولاً pronounced as 'ma'mulan'.
Why are there two different ways to say 'not' in this sentence (نیست and ندارد)?
For the verb 'to be', the negative is a specific word: است (is) becomes نیست (is not). But for almost all other verbs like 'to have', you make them negative by just adding the prefix نـ (na-). So دارد (he has) becomes ندارد (he does not have).
Does او only mean 'he'?
No, Farsi pronouns are completely gender-neutral. او (u) can mean 'he' or 'she' depending on the context. If we were talking about a woman, the Farsi sentence would remain exactly the same.
